Driving across the border
Yes — you can drive from Liberia into Ivory Coast, and you should carry an International Driving Permit alongside your national licence. Ivory Coast expects foreign drivers to hold an IDP, in the 1949 Geneva format. Both countries drive on the right, so there is no change of driving side at the border. Plan your border crossing in advance and keep your passport, national licence and IDP together.

Crossing the border
Liberia and Ivory Coast share a land border you can cross by car. Keep your passport, national driving licence and International Driving Permit together, and check opening hours and any toll or vignette requirements before you travel.
Driving rules in Ivory Coast
- Drive on the right.
- Toll motorway between Abidjan and Yamoussoukro.
- 0.08% alcohol limit.
- Carry passport, IDP and home licence.
